Each speaker was tested in a 15x20 ft room at multiple volume levels. Audio quality was evaluated blind against reference tracks. Voice recognition was tested with 50 standardized commands at 10 and 20 feet. Smart home compatibility was tested with 20+ devices across Zigbee, Z-Wave, Matter, and Thread protocols.

Pick Your Ecosystem First
Before buying any smart speaker, decide which ecosystem you're in. If you use an iPhone and Mac, Apple HomePod's deep integration is worth the premium. Android users get the most from Google Nest Audio. If you're neutral, Amazon Alexa has the largest third-party skill library and device compatibility.
Switching ecosystems later means replacing all your speakers — choose deliberately.

Audio Quality vs Smart Features
There's a real tension between audio quality and smart features. Purpose-built smart speakers (Echo, Nest Audio) compromise audio for price and smart integrations. Premium options like HomePod and Sonos Era 100 prioritize audio but cost more.
If you primarily want music, spend more on audio quality. If you primarily want smart home control, the Echo's Zigbee hub adds more daily value than better bass.
Multi-Room Audio: Is It Worth It?
Multi-room audio lets you play synchronized music throughout your home. Sonos is the gold standard — their system works with every streaming service and sounds excellent in every room. Amazon's multi-room works well within Alexa devices. Apple's AirPlay 2 is seamless for Apple Music users.
For most people, two Echo devices is enough. Only invest in premium multi-room if you regularly host gatherings or want whole-home audio coverage.
